Word. Click the picture you want to add a caption to. Click References Insert Caption. To use the default label (Figure), type your caption in the Caption box.

How to Add Text to Images Online Upload your image. Upload the photo that you want to add text to or paste a link to your image. Add and style text. Use the Text tool to add text to images. Export and share. Hit Export and Kapwing will instantly process your photo with the added text.
Go to Photos and select the photo you want. Tap Edit, then tap the Markup button . Tap the Add button to add text, shapes, and more. Tap Done, then tap Done again.
Add Text to Photos on Android Using Google Photos Open a photo in Google Photos. At the bottom of the photo, tap Edit (three horizontal lines). Tap the Markup icon (squiggly line). You can also select the color of text from this screen. Tap the Text tool and enter your desired text. Select Done when youve finished.
